3. What We Collect
3a. Data You Give Us
- Google OAuth: Name, email, profile photo. We never see your Google password.
- Profile: Username, bio, avatar, and any other profile fields you fill in.
- Content: Posts, comments, DMs, images, links, event listings, community content — everything you create on the Platform.
- XP & Promotion Data: Events or content you promote, XP earned, XP purchased, and promotion duration/settings.
- Payment Data: When you purchase XP, payment is processed entirely by Cashfree Payments. We do not store your card details, CVV, UPI ID, or bank credentials. We only receive a transaction confirmation reference ID from Cashfree. Cashfree's Privacy Policy governs their handling of your financial data.
- Support & Grievance: Emails and messages you send us.
3b. Automatically Collected
- IP address and approximate location (country/city level)
- Browser, device type, OS, and screen resolution
- Pages visited, features used, session duration
- Referral URLs and navigation flow
- Error logs and crash data
- Cookies and local storage set by us or our infrastructure providers (Vercel, Cashfree)
3c. What We Do NOT Collect
- Aadhaar, PAN, passport, or any government-issued ID
- Full payment card or bank account data (Cashfree handles this)
- Data from persons knowingly under 18
- Precise real-time location (GPS)

6. Storage, Security, and Retention
We apply reasonable technical and organisational measures to protect your data. However, no system is completely secure, and we cannot guarantee absolute protection against breaches. You use the Platform at your own risk in this respect.
Data may be stored on servers outside India (via Vercel, US-based). You consent to this cross-border storage by using the Platform.
Retention periods: account data — until deletion request or account inactivity >2 years; transaction/payment records (XP purchases, refunds) — minimum 3 years for legal/financial compliance; legal/grievance records — as required by applicable law. You may request deletion at namanaryan002@gmail.com, subject to retention obligations.
In the event of a personal data breach likely to result in risk to Data Principals, we will notify affected users and report to the Data Protection Board of India within 72 hours of becoming aware. Notification will be sent to your registered email and posted on the Platform.
7. Your Rights (DPDP Act 2023 / IT Act 2000)
- Access: Request a summary of your personal data we hold.
- Correction: Request correction of inaccurate data.
- Erasure: Request deletion of your data. Transaction records may be retained per legal obligations even after account deletion.
- Withdraw Consent: Withdraw consent (delete your account) at any time. Withdrawal does not undo prior processing.
- Grievance Redressal: File a grievance with our Grievance Officer. If unresolved in 15 days, escalate to the Data Protection Board of India (under DPDP Act 2023).
- Nomination: Under DPDP Act 2023, you may nominate someone to exercise your rights in case of death or incapacity.
